  5. I have 2 ea TP1B70MH Worm Rods & 1 ea TP1B74H Pitching Rod The 7' MH are excellent worm/jig rods for weights 1/8-1/2 oz. The 7'4" H is excellent frog rod, flipping-n-pitching rod, & Medium punch rod up to 1 oz. Pretty agree with @Brian11719 accessment

  7. Buzz Worms comes in 8" & 12", I've had better luck with the 8" in green pumpkin blue tail. I would also suggest Yamamoto's 10” Ichi Worm, it's made from Yamamoto’s Mega Floater Formula, which makes the tail stand up off the bottom. It's heavy enough to good distance unweighted.

  12. IDK 😉 2007 was my best year ever on Toledo Bend, the lake level was 15' low. I generally target 15' +/- 3', which means where I normally fish I was walking around kicking dust. I ended the year with 11 double digits including a 12 lb 8 oz PB. 2008 the lake level came back up to normal, the fish scattered & the big bite fell off

  18. Even with FFS next after location is timing; just because you don't get bit does not mean the bass aren't there or you tied on the wrong lure. It could just be they simply aren't feeding. . To consistently catch bass is a process of elimination & duplication. Eliminate patterns & waters that are non-productive, & duplicate patterns and waters that are productive.
